Guisborough Child Abuser
A man named Mark Tilley, who was a former director of a company in Guisborough, has been found guilty by a jury at Teesside Crown Court of multiple child sex offences. Tilley, aged 60, was reported missing after his conviction for numerous counts of raping and indecently assaulting a girl under 14 during the 1990s. Following the verdict on all six charges, police launched an appeal to locate him since he did not appear in court. Cleveland Police later confirmed that he had been found. The trial and subsequent investigations validated his involvement in these serious crimes, and his conviction represents a significant legal outcome in this case.
